1. Biography of Dee Dee Blanchard

Dee Dee Blanchard was born on September 1, 1967, in Chackbay, Louisiana. Throughout her early life, she faced many challenges, including a difficult family environment. Dee Dee became a mother to Gypsy Rose in 1991, and from that point, her life took a dramatic turn.

Dee Dee presented herself as a caring mother who devoted her life to taking care of her daughter, who she claimed had numerous debilitating medical conditions, including leukemia, muscular dystrophy, and other ailments. However, it was later revealed that many of these claims were fabricated or exaggerated, as Dee Dee suffered from Munchausen syndrome by proxy, a psychological disorder that causes a caregiver to induce or fabricate illness in their dependents.

3. Events Leading Up to the Murder

Several events led to the tragic murder of Dee Dee Blanchard. Gypsy Rose, who had grown increasingly aware of her mother’s manipulations, began to seek independence as she reached her teenage years. The abuse she suffered at the hands of her mother was severe, with Dee Dee controlling her life entirely, leading Gypsy to feel trapped and desperate.

In early 2015, Gypsy met a man named Nicholas Godejohn online, and they began a romantic relationship. Gypsy confided in Nicholas about her mother’s abusive behavior and expressed her desire to escape. This relationship would ultimately play a pivotal role in the events that unfolded leading up to the murder.

5. Aftermath of the Crime

The aftermath of Dee Dee Blanchard's murder was a media frenzy, with the story capturing national attention. Gypsy Rose and Nicholas were both arrested, and legal proceedings began. Gypsy's case was particularly controversial, as many sympathized with her plight and the abuse she had endured throughout her life.

Gypsy ultimately pled guilty to second-degree murder in 2016 and was sentenced to ten years in prison. Nicholas Godejohn was charged with first-degree murder and was sentenced to life in prison. The case raised numerous ethical questions about justice, mental health, and the impact of abuse.
